      Hi guys, whenever I try to play a game on the default zx emulator, I only play it using keyboard.
      I have a USB controller connected, so I would like to know if the emulator recognizes my gamepad and assigns to a "joystick" (kempston or interface) or must I configure it (where?).

        I needed to check the code to solve that when I first encountered it!!!

        Open opt/retropie/configs/zxspectrum/retroarch.config

        Substitute its content with this:

        # Settings made here will only override settings in the global retroarch.cfg if placed above the #include line
        
        input_remapping_directory = "/opt/retropie/configs/zxspectrum/"
        input_libretro_device_p1 = "513"
        
        #include "/opt/retropie/configs/all/retroarch.cfg"
